Notice from the Polish Red Cross in France to Berle Perlmutter, May 2, 1946, about the fate of Pola Wygodzka, Małgorzata Steinlaufowa, and Jozef Wygodzki. Notice from the tracing department of the Polish Red Cross branch in France, May 2, 1946, to Berle Perlmutter in Marseille, France. In the notice, sent at the request of the district Jewish committee in Częstochowa, it is stated that Pola Wygodzka and Małgorzata Steinlaufowa, along with their children, were murdered by the Gestapo...
